    Abstract:

    NADPmalate enzyme (NADPME) is a key photosynthetic enzyme in C4 plants and plays an important role in biotic and abiotic stress. To further study the function of NADPME, we cloned the NADPME family gene sequences from the leaves of C3C4 species Salsola laricifolia, and then determined the expression patterns in tissues under different abiotic stresses. We also cloned NADPMEs promoter sequences and analyzed the element differences in response to abiotic stress based on bioinformatics software. The results showed that: (1) three NADPMEs were obtained, named SaNADPME1, SaNADPME2 and SaNADPME4, with the length of CDS sequence was 1 755 bp, 1 758 bp and 1 941 bp, respectively. (2) SaNADPME1 was mainly expressed in roots, while SaNADPME2 and SaNADPME4 were mainly expressed in leaves. Under the stress of ABA, NaCl, NaHCO3 and PEG6000, three NADPMEs could be induced to express in Salsola laricifolia, and the response expression patterns of SaNADPME4 and SaNADPME2 were similar. (3) The length of promoter regions of SaNADPME1, SaNADPME2, and SaNADPME4 were 2 351 bp, 1 655 bp and 2 887 bp. Bioinformatics analysis showed that they contained not only basic promoter elements, but also elements in response to stress response.
